At Altran Corp., we specialize in the design, manufacturing, and testing of electric transformers for a wide range of industrial and commercial applications. With decades of experience behind us, we’ve built our reputation on engineering excellence, precision craftsmanship, and a deep commitment to innovation. Our product lineup spans custom and standard transformer solutions, including power transformers, distribution transformers, and specialized units built to perform in harsh or demanding environments. We bring a solutions-focused mindset to every project, working closely with our customers to ensure each transformer meets not only the technical specifications but also the performance and longevity expectations of their systems.

We operate with vertically integrated capabilities that allow us to control quality at every stage of production, from core winding and assembly to insulation and final testing. Our in-house engineering team leverages advanced modeling tools to optimize each design for thermal efficiency, electrical performance, and compact form factor. We also offer repair, refurbishment, and retrofitting services, helping customers extend the life of existing equipment and reduce downtime. Whether we’re supporting utility infrastructure, powering industrial automation, or supplying OEMs with built-to-spec units, we pride ourselves on delivering reliable, durable transformer solutions backed by technical expertise and responsive service.
